The Project of the African Ghana Asogli Phase II was Honored the Ghana-West African Business Excellence Awards for the Power Generation Company of the Year
28 May 2024Recently, the project of two 9E gas turbine power plants of the African Ghana Asogli Phase II 360MW, which is EPC contracted and maintained by China Energy Engineering Group Guangdong Power Engineering Co., Ltd., was honored the "Ghana-West African Business Excellence Awards for the Power Generation Company of the Year".
The project was put into operation in 2017, and it only took 11 months to complete the construction task of the first unit, refreshing the record of the construction speed of similar power generation projects in Africa. The completion of the project has effectively improved Ghana's electricity supply capacity, providing 20% of the nation's electricity. Currently, Guangdong Power Engineering is responsible for the minor class, B class, and major class equipment maintenance, and corresponding equipment technical transformation and upgrade services for the entire Phase I and II plants. Since undertaking the routine maintenance of the equipment, Guangdong Power Engineering has continuously strengthened preventive maintenance of the equipment, fully recognized by the power plant for its work in optimizing operation and equipment management. It is now playing an important role in terms of the safe and stable operation of the power plant locally.
